Mountain biking around Bentley Pauncefoot offers a blend of serene rural landscapes and access to more challenging country parks. The area features quiet country lanes, expansive farmland, and a network of public bridleways suitable for cycling. While Bentley Pauncefoot itself provides gentle waterways and scenic routes around the Tardebigge Reservoir, its proximity to Lickey Hills Country Park and Waseley Hills Country Park significantly expands the mountain biking opportunities. Very quiet place, which is popular among runners and walkers. However, Worcestershire&Birmingham channel is relatively well-surfaced at this section (compacted gravel with some cobblestones). So, it can be carefully(!) completed on road bikes with decent tires. If not, then ~1km of pushing in total from the nearest road.

Situated on the Worcester and Birmingham Canal, Alvechurch Marina is close to the impressive 30-lock Tardebigge Flight, the Weighbridge pub and Alvechurch train station.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many mountain bike trails are available around Bentley Pauncefoot?

There are over 35 mountain bike trails around Bentley Pauncefoot, offering a diverse range of experiences. These include routes through quiet country lanes, dedicated bridleways, and the more varied terrain of nearby country parks.

What kind of terrain can I expect when mountain biking near Bentley Pauncefoot?

The terrain varies significantly. Around Bentley Pauncefoot itself, you'll find serene rural landscapes with quiet country lanes, farmland, and public bridleways. For more challenging rides, nearby Lickey Hills Country Park offers rolling wood and heathland with some 'stupid steep' sections, while Waseley Hills Country Park features picturesque hilltops and varied trails, including some steep climbs. Routes around the Tardebigge Reservoir often follow canal paths.

Are there easy mountain bike trails suitable for beginners?

Yes, there are 17 easy mountain bike trails in the area. Many routes along the canals, such as the Forest Downhill Trail – Alvechurch Marina loop from Redditch, offer gentle gradients and are suitable for beginners or those looking for a relaxed ride. These trails often explore local countryside and canal paths.

Are there challenging mountain bike trails for advanced riders?

While the immediate Bentley Pauncefoot area is generally gentler, the nearby Lickey Hills Country Park is known for its more demanding terrain, including some very steep sections that will challenge advanced riders. The varied landscapes of Waseley Hills Country Park also offer trails with steep sections for those seeking a more intense experience.

What scenic views or landmarks can I see while mountain biking?

You can enjoy panoramic views over Worcestershire and into Birmingham from spots like the Beacon Hill Toposcope in Lickey Hills Country Park. Waseley Hills Country Park also provides fantastic views stretching as far as mid-Wales. Additionally, many routes feature the historic Tardebigge Locks, a notable landmark along the canal.

Can I bring my dog on the mountain bike trails?

Yes, dogs are generally welcome on public bridleways and in country parks like Lickey Hills and Waseley Hills, provided they are kept under control, especially around livestock and other visitors. Always follow local signage and regulations regarding dogs.

Where can I park when mountain biking near Bentley Pauncefoot?

Parking is available at key access points for the country parks. Lickey Hills Country Park has a visitor centre with parking, and Waseley Hills Country Park also offers parking facilities. For routes starting directly in Bentley Pauncefoot, roadside parking may be available, but it's always best to check specific starting points for designated parking areas.

Is public transport available to access mountain bike trails?

Public transport options exist to reach the general area. For instance, Lickey Hills Country Park is accessible by bus from Birmingham. However, direct public transport links to specific trailheads within Bentley Pauncefoot itself might be limited, making a car often the most convenient option for accessing the wider network of trails and country parks.

Are there cafes or pubs along the mountain bike routes?

Yes, you can find refreshment stops. The Windmill Cafe is located within Waseley Hills Country Park. Additionally, many routes pass through or near villages and towns where pubs and cafes are available. For example, the Tardebigge Top Lock – Lock 53 loop from Wirehill explores the scenic canal area, which often has waterside establishments.

What is the best time of year for mountain biking in Bentley Pauncefoot?

Spring and autumn generally offer the most pleasant conditions for mountain biking, with milder temperatures and beautiful scenery. Summer can be excellent, but trails might be busier. Winter riding is possible, but some trails, especially in the country parks, can become muddy and challenging, so appropriate gear and caution are advised.
